Course Content

• Fundamentals of Speech Recognition
• Acoustic Modeling and Hidden Markov Models (HMM)
• Deep Learning for Speech Recognition (DNN, RNN, CNN)
• Mathematical Foundations of Speech Signal Processing
• Language Modeling and N-gram Models
• Speech Recognition Evaluation Metrics
• Advanced Topics in Mathematical Speech Recognition Models
• Practical Implementation and Deployment of Speech Recognition Systems

Career path

Career Role (Mathematical Speech Recognition) Description
Speech Scientist (Machine Learning) Develops and improves speech recognition algorithms using advanced mathematical models, focusing on accuracy and efficiency. High demand in UK tech.
AI Engineer (Speech Processing) Designs, builds, and deploys AI-powered speech recognition systems, integrating mathematical models for optimal performance. Strong mathematical foundation essential.
Data Scientist (Audio Analytics) Analyzes large audio datasets to extract meaningful insights, leveraging mathematical modeling for speech recognition improvements. Crucial role in refining models.
Machine Learning Researcher (Speech Recognition) Conducts research on novel mathematical models for speech recognition, pushing the boundaries of current technology. Highly specialized, high-reward role.
